Funny Bunny Poem by Linda Marie Van Tassell

I am no Playboy Bunny, honey.
I like sweetmeats, popcorn, and candy.
You might laugh and think that it's funny,
but muffintops come in quite handy.
I loathe exercise and a treadmill.
I am pleasantly plump and curvy.
I have the desire but lack the will.
I am what some call topsy-turvy.

I am surely no ugly duckling,
but I will not sport a bikini.
I am really great for a snuggling
but will never be a yogini.
I am moon pie, snookums, and cheesecake.
I am sweet cheeks, honeybun, and fluff.
I am kissy face, biscuit, milkshake,
cuddle bundle, boo, and powder puff.

I've had my days of fun in the sun.
I made it out to the other side.
The bunny trail provides a nice run,
but I rather like it here inside.
Hippity, hoppity, floppity,
this is my life and story to scale.
If you don't like it, no loss for me.
Pucker up and kiss my cottontail.
